In 2013, at the age of 23, my brother Darrian donated 68% of his liver to save our father. It was an amazing, courageous and selfless gesture, and it was successful. He healed quickly and was back to his old self faster than any of us thought possible for what he went through.
However, since his surgery he has been having episodes of stomach pain. He has been in and out of the hospital, each time with no answers.
Very early Sunday morning, January 18, Darrian and Amy returned to the hospital in Calgary once again because Darrian was experiencing extreme stomach pain. After some tests and an x-ray, it was (once again) diagnosed as a minor issue. He was given different pain meds that didn't help the pain and was finally given a CT Scan. It was discovered that there was a 4 inch hole in his diaphragm. Doctors decided that he would need an operation and began attempting to schedule one. While waiting, Darrian's blood pressure began dropping, and things got very bad very quickly, as they couldn’t find a pulse and he went into shock. He was rushed into surgery around 3pm January 18. After nearly 6 hours of surgery, we found out that Darrian's intestines had pushed through the hole in his diaphragm where they died because they were strangulated and had cut off blood supply, this affected his heart, and put pressure on his lungs. His dead bowel was essentially poisoning him. Doctors removed about 3 feet of his bowel and some of his colon to save his life. Due to his unstable blood pressure and heart rate, he was taken out of surgery but kept sedated until January 19, when they completed a second surgery to finish cleaning him out and fixing his organs. He is young and otherwise healthy, and he is a fighter! It is now clear that this issue was a complication from his initial liver surgery and it is unknown how this will affect his future.
